1. Visit the Grand Gwalior Fort

Visit the Grand Gwalior Fort-Things to Do in Gwalior

The Gwalior Fort is one of the most popular and prominent Gwalior tourist attractions, which is a grandiose building that serves as the monument of the Indian history. This huge fort is located on a hilltop, which provides a panoramic view of the city and has exquisite palaces, temples, and water tanks inside its vicinity.

Spend some time to visit the beautiful Man Singh Palace with its beautiful blue tiles and the old Gujari Mahal Museum to know more about the history of the region. Strolling in the wide courtyards and ramparts of the fort is certainly one of the best things to do in Gwalior.

2. Go to Jai Vilas Palace

Go to Jai Vilas Palace

The Jai Vilas Palace is another architectural masterpiece that signifies royal splendor. This palace was constructed in the 19th century and it is a mixture of European and Indian style. The museum of the palace has a large number of royal artifacts, old cars, and detailed furniture.

Do not forget to visit the Durbar Hall with its beautiful chandeliers and the huge dining table which used to be a venue of great banquets. Jai Vilas Palace is the must see in Gwalior as a traveler.

3. Find out the Mysterious Sas Bahu Temples

Find out the Mysterious Sas Bahu Temples-Things to Do in Gwalior

Sas Bahu Temples are an architectural wonder built in the 11 th century. Although the name of these temples implies mother-in-law and daughter-in-law, they are devoted to Lord Vishnu and his wife Lakshmi. The temples are highly carved and well sculptured with pillars that portray the art work of the time.

The temples are a serene place to stay and are ideal to visit in case you are interested in the ancient Indian temple architecture-a rare item on your list of things to do in Gwalior.

5. Walk Through the Tomb of Tansen

Walk Through the Tomb of Tansen-Things to Do in Gwalior

Gwalior is famous for its association with Tansen, the legendary musician of Emperor Akbar’s court. The Tomb of Tansen is a revered site and a must-visit for music enthusiasts. The tomb’s architecture is a fine example of Mughal design, and its surroundings are peaceful and green.

Every year, a music festival is held here to honor Tansen’s legacy, offering visitors a chance to experience classical Indian music in its purest form.

6. Explore the Gujari Mahal Archaeological Museum

Explore the Gujari Mahal Archaeological Museum

For those who want to delve deeper into the history and culture of Gwalior, the Gujari Mahal Archaeological Museum is a treasure trove. Located within the Gwalior Fort complex, the museum houses a remarkable collection of sculptures, coins, and artifacts from the region’s past.

Exploring this museum is a great way to understand the rich heritage of Gwalior and is one of the educational Gwalior things to do for curious travelers.

8. Stroll Along the Scindia Museum

Stroll Along the Scindia Museum

Situated in the Jai Vilas Palace complex, the Scindia Museum gives a glimpse into the opulent lifestyle of the Scindia dynasty. With its vast collection of royal belongings, paintings, and arms, the museum narrates the story of one of India’s most prominent royal families.

The museum’s well-maintained gardens and grand architecture make it a popular spot for tourists wanting to explore places to see in Gwalior.

9. Enjoy the Local Cuisine and Markets

Enjoy the Local Cuisine and Markets-Things to Do in Gwalior

No travel experience is complete without tasting local flavors. Gwalior’s street food and markets offer a delightful experience with local delicacies such as Poha, Jalebi, and Kachori. The bustling markets are also perfect for shopping traditional handicrafts, textiles, and souvenirs.

Enjoying the local cuisine and shopping is among the most vibrant Gwalior things to do that connects you with the city’s everyday life.

Tips for Visiting Gwalior 

  • Best time to visit is from October to March when the weather is pleasant.
  • Local transportation like auto-rickshaws and taxis are easily available.
  • Hire a local guide for a deeper understanding of historical sites.
  • Don’t forget to carry comfortable walking shoes for exploring forts and museums.
